Installation Considerations and Fastening Systems
While the material is robust, proper installation is critical to maximizing the lifespan and appearance of the deck. Most composite boards feature hidden-fastener systems that use clips or screws designed specifically for the material. These systems secure the boards internally, creating a smooth, seamless surface free of exposed hardware. Proper spacing of support joists is essential to prevent sagging and ensure the characteristic rigid "thump" when stepping on the boards, which differs significantly from the hollow sound of treated lumber.

Addressing the Thermal Properties
A common consideration for homeowners in warmer climates is the surface temperature of the decking material. Concrete composite decking exhibits higher thermal mass than traditional wood, meaning it absorbs and retains heat. During peak sunlight hours, the deck surface can become quite warm to the touch. However, this characteristic also means the surface remains comfortable underfoot during cooler parts of the day. Selecting lighter color tones can effectively reflect solar radiation, keeping the surface temperature closer to ambient air temperature.
